Understanding Lexus LFA Costs in Today's Market

When talking about the Lexus LFA, it's essential to know that this car is incredibly rare. Lexus produced only 500 units globally between 2010 and 2012, making it a genuine collector's item. Its price today reflects its scarcity and groundbreaking engineering achievements, including its iconic V10 engine.

In current markets, typical Lexus LFA prices generally range from approximately 2,200,000 AED to well over 3,700,000 AED (roughly 2,200,000 SAR to 3,700,000 SAR). Private sales, auctions, and dealer listings can vary significantly depending on market trends.

What Makes the Lexus LFA Unique?

Several features set this car apart:

  • Unforgettable sound: The high-revving 4.8-liter V10 engine produces one of the most iconic exhaust notes ever made by a road car.

  • Limited production: Only 500 units were handcrafted, ensuring its exclusivity for collectors worldwide.

  • Advanced technology: The car features a lightweight carbon fiber-reinforced polymer body, delivering exceptional performance and handling.

Lexus LFA Price Key Factors

The price of the Lexus LFA isn't static. Different factors play a role in determining the selling price of each car. Here are the most important ones:

Vehicle Condition and History

  • Mileage matters: Lexus LFAs with lower mileage are typically priced higher. Many owners limit driving to preserve value.

  • Full service records: Documentation showing professional care boosts resale prices.

  • Original parts: Modified or restored LFAs may cost less than those in factory-original condition.

Current Market Demand for Performance Cars

  • Collector interest: There is enduring demand for Japanese performance cars, especially rare ones like the LFA.

  • Global markets: Prices for exceptional supercars tend to rise as demand grows worldwide.

  • Scarcity: With just 500 units ever made, market prices stay competitive as fewer cars come up for sale.

Purchase Variations

Where and how buyers purchase the Lexus LFA also matters. Auction prices may exceed those of private sales, but private listings could offer rare finds. Additionally, seller trustworthiness and vehicle maintenance records impact overall costs.

FAQ

Q: What is the Lexus LFA selling for now?

A: Current prices range widely. You can expect well-maintained cars to be listed between approximately 2,200,000 AED and 3,700,000 AED (or 2,200,000 SAR to 3,700,000 SAR). Auctions may see even higher bids for special editions or cars in prime condition.

Q: Why is the Lexus LFA so expensive?

A: The Lexus LFA commands high prices due to its rarity, groundbreaking engineering, and undeniable collector appeal. Its hand-built quality, limited production of 500 units, and advanced carbon fiber construction contribute to its exclusivity.

Q: When was the last Lexus LFA made?

A: The Lexus LFA was produced between late 2010 and late 2012. The final cars, including Nürburgring Editions, were completed in December 2012, marking the end of its production cycle.
